The Front Office Executive is responsible for providing exceptional guest service by handling check-ins, check-outs, reservations, guest inquiries, and ensuring a smooth front desk operation. The role serves as the first point of contact for guests and plays a key role in creating a positive guest experience.
Key Responsibilities
• Welcome guests in a courteous and professional manner.
• Perform guest check-in and check-out procedures efficiently.
• Handle room reservations, cancellations, and modifications.
• Answer telephone calls and respond to guest inquiries promptly.
• Coordinate with Housekeeping, Engineering, and Food & Beverage departments to fulfill guest requests.
• Maintain accurate guest records and update the Property Management System (PMS).
• Process guest payments and prepare bills accurately.
• Handle guest complaints professionally and escalate issues when required.
• Ensure the front desk and lobby are clean, organized, and presentable.
• Maintain cash float and prepare daily cashier reports.
• Assist with VIP arrivals and departures.
• Follow hotel policies, SOPs, and safety procedures.
• Prepare daily reports, occupancy reports, and shift handover notes.
• Promote hotel services and upsell rooms and facilities whenever possible.
Qualifications
• Bachelor's degree or Diploma in Hotel Management, Hospitality, or a related field.
• 1–3 years of experience in hotel front office operations (freshers may be considered for trainee roles).
• Knowledge of hotel PMS (Opera, IDS, Fidelio, or similar) is preferred.
• Proficiency in MS Office.
